Cheesy Puff Pastry Asparagus Tart

This Cheesy Puff Pastry Asparagus Tart is the perfect snack, side, or appetizer. And, this savory recipe is super easy to make!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Appetizer, Side Dish
Cuisine American
Servings 8

Ingredients
  

  • 1 sheet frozen puff pastry (thawed)
  • 1 cup white cheddar cheese (shredded)
  • 1 lb medium asparagus (trimmed)
  • 1 teaspo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ar
  • ½ teaspoon salt (or to taste)
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per (or to taste)
  • 1 tablespoon Parmesan cheese (grated)
  • 1 egg

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 450F and line a large baking pan with parchment paper.
  • Prepare and roll out the puff pastry into a 10x15-inch rectangle on a lightly floured surface. Transfer to the prepared baking pan.
  • Use a knife to gently score a 1-inch border around the pastry dough with shallow cuts (do not cut through the pastry).
  • Inside the scored border, lightly poke holes all over the pastry dough with a fork (do not poke through the dough).
  • Sprinkle cheddar cheese evenly over the pastry inside the border and top with asparagus in a single layer alternating ends and tips.
  • In a small bowl, add ol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per, and stir to combine. Brush the mixture over the asparagus and top with Parmesan cheese.
  • In another small bowl, beat egg with a fork. Brush the egg wash over the border on all sides.
  • Bake for 15 to 20 minutes until the crust is golden brown and puffy.
  • Let the tart cool for 2-3 minutes before slicing and serving.
